Building Meaningful Friendships: Insights from C.S. Lewisโs 'The Four Loves'
In this episode of the Simplified Organization Podcast, Mystie Winckler, Karen Head, Adelaide Garner, and Kate Myers discuss the importance of community and friendship through the lens of C.S. Lewisโs book 'The Four Loves.'
The conversation explores how group dynamics contribute to stable, long-term friendships and the value of camaraderie among women. Women must remember to balance close, intimate connections and broader community ties. One beautiful part of friend groups is how they bring out different facets of each individual.

Unpacking Friendship: Insights from C.S. Lewis's 'The Four Loves' โ Part 2
In this episode of the Simplified Organization Podcast, Mystie Winckler and her guests, Karen Head, Adelaide Garner, and Kate Myers, delve deeper into the concept of friendship as depicted in C. S. Lewis's book, 'The Four Loves.' They explore the distinction between true friendships and general acquaintances, discussing the unique spiritual depth and co-laboring nature of genuine friendships.
The conversation touches on potential pitfalls of friendship and compares them to family and marital relationships, incorporating personal anecdotes and interpretations of Lewis's views. They conclude by emphasizing the importance of intellectual stimulation and mutual support in friendships, paving the way for a more profound connection.

Mystie and Anna Laura Farnham discuss effective methods for managing kids' chores and household tasks. Learn about the Baby Step Bingo challenge, chore charts, and decluttering techniques that turn everyday tasks into engaging activities. Discover how to keep kids motivated and foster a cooperative family environment, ultimately getting more done with gratitude and creativity.
Anna Laura and her husband, Gandalf, live in Indiana and have six children ranging in age from toddler to teenager. Before kids, she earned two music degrees in oboe performance and worked in a corporate office, but she has set aside those careers to focus on being a mom and homemaker. She and her family stay busy with church fellowship, several sports, music, reading and generally being creative.
**Focus on Baby Steps:** Anna learned to tackle small tasks one at a time, like removing cobwebs or wiping down the washing machine. These small steps made a big difference, especially during hectic times like pregnancy or postpartum.
- **Gamified Chores:** Anna translated the lessons from Baby Step Bingo into practical training tools for her children. Tasks are broken into manageable chunks, and the kids get to experience a sense of accomplishment when they check off items from their bingo charts.
- **Customizing for Each Child:** Each child's bingo chart is slightly different, catering to their specific needs and capabilities. This ensures that chores aren't monotonous and helps keep the kids engaged.
- **Age Appropriateness:** For younger children, like her five-year-old, Anna uses a smaller 4x4 bingo chart and simpler tasks. This approach makes it easier for them to participate and feel involved.
- **Encouraging Early Participation:** While her two-year-old doesn't have a structured bingo chart, she imitates her older siblings and helps out in small ways, fostering a sense of contribution from a young age.
**Adding Excitement to Household Chores**
Anna finds that changing up daily routines with something like Baby Step Bingo can make a big difference. For example, before a holiday or trip, they might include tasks like vacuuming a vehicle or packing clothes in the bingo charts. This adds variety and makes mundane chores exciting.
